She’s known for being a bit of a marmite character, but we reckon there are a lot of mums out there who will just love Anne Hathaway for her latest comments.

 

The Les Misérables actress welcomed her first child, Jonathan, back in March, and she had plenty to say on the dreaded ‘post-baby body’ subject this weekend.

 

Stepping out for the premiere of her new movie, Colossal, the 33-year-old said she is fully embracing the changes that motherhood has brought to her body.

“I’m not trying to recapture something that was. I’m going with what it is now,” she told InStyle.

 

The award-winning actress added: “Some things, I guess, are the same as they were, and other things are a little bit different. I’m just so proud of what the changes signify. So, there’s no rush to do anything.”

 

While the very thought of exercise is enough to reduce us to tears – especially when we have little ones to look after – Anne now has a totally different philosophy, it seems.

 

 

“I find that my workout is really different now, because I gave birth. I feel like doing burpees now, after having a baby, is zero big deal,” she said.

 

When you think about it, she totally has a point – if we can go through hours of painful labour, a few squats here and there are not going to break us!
